🌍 Conflict and Humanitarian Concerns

Ongoing conflicts around the world continue to create serious humanitarian challenges, affecting millions of civilians. From displacement and food shortages to healthcare crises, war and instability remain major obstacles to global peace and human development.


⚔️ Ongoing Conflicts and Civilian Impact

Armed conflicts in various regions have forced civilians to bear the greatest burden. Fighting often damages homes, hospitals, schools, and vital infrastructure, leaving communities vulnerable and exposed.

Common impacts include:

  • Mass displacement and refugee movements
  • Civilian casualties and human rights violations
  • Destruction of basic services
  • Long-term psychological trauma

Women, children, and the elderly are often the most affected.


🚨 Humanitarian Aid Under Pressure

Humanitarian organizations are working under extreme conditions to provide food, shelter, medical care, and clean water. However, access to conflict zones remains difficult due to security risks, funding shortages, and political restrictions.

Aid workers face:

  • Limited access to affected areas
  • Supply chain disruptions
  • Growing demand with reduced resources

These challenges slow relief efforts and deepen human suffering.


🌍 Global Response and Responsibility

The international community plays a critical role in addressing humanitarian crises. Governments, global institutions, and NGOs are called upon to:

  • Support ceasefire initiatives
  • Increase humanitarian funding
  • Protect civilians under international law
  • Support long-term recovery and peacebuilding

Failure to act risks worsening instability beyond conflict zones.


Long-Term Consequences

Humanitarian crises caused by conflict have lasting effects. They weaken economies, disrupt education, and create cycles of poverty and violence. Without sustainable solutions, temporary aid cannot prevent future crises.

Peace, accountability, and development must go hand in hand.
